Output 95894076981655d08993e83a8ceb42046ba9755a01785d1822475419544d5528:0

value
2684151
script pubkey
OP_HASH160 OP_PUSHBYTES_20 06943358650ea3c0292c3de096ed876419e6daa5 OP_EQUAL
address
M8Vwpjhwam84Vph3Sq5Qdha6U5FxhdUrZ4
transaction
95894076981655d08993e83a8ceb42046ba9755a01785d1822475419544d5528
spent
true